Abstract
This paper presents a method for extracting intersecting pipelines weld seam based on point cloud. Firstly, the collected point cloud is filtered by PassThrough filter to extract the region of interest, and the intersecting pipelines model is reconstructed by using the camera calibration results and the pose of robot. Then VoxelGrid filtering and Moving Least Squares filtering are performed on the reconstructed model to smooth the error caused by camera and robot. The Fast Point Feature Histograms of point cloud is used to calculate the entropy map, and the weld seam region is extracted by threshold segmentation. Finally, an iterative algorithm for weld point extraction based on entropy is proposed. Through experimental verification, the algorithm can extract the weld points of the actual intersecting pipelines and obtain the real position of the weld points in the robot base coordinate frame, which has great application value in robot automatic welding area.
